- Inscriptions: "Lyndon Dadswell; Art; L18644; 1950"--On compactus card; "Australian sculptor Lyndon Dadswell in his Edgecliff studio, Sydney. After his return from completing his studies at the Royal Academy, London, Dadswell commenced in 1929, at the age of 21, the 12 panels in the Shrine of Remembrance, Melbourne, which depic every unit of the Australian Forces in action during the 1914-1918 war. He has won many competitions, including the Wynne Art Prize, and today is Head Teacher of Sculpture at East Sydney Technical School. Australian Official Photograph. L.18644. Art Personalities."--Typewritten sheet attached to verso.
